Conformal Coating Solution

With electronics required to meet stringent reliability standards such as IPC-CC-830, MIL-I-46058C, and ISO 9001, conformal coating has become a critical process to protect circuit boards from moisture, corrosion, and electrical leakage. To achieve consistent film thickness (typically 25–75 µm) and edge coverage on densely packed components, coating materials must be dispensed with high precision. That’s why a conformal coating system must be tailored to meet application requirements and overcome some process challenges.

Key Challenges

Material dripping from delayed shut-off

Overspray & material waste

Inconsistent flow rate cause uneven thickness

Air bubbles due to unstable pressure

Conformal Coating Application in Typical Industries

Electronics & Semiconductors

Electronics & Semiconductors

Protecting PCBs, sensors, and IC modules from moisture, corrosion, and ionic contamination.

Automotive Electronics

Automotive Electronics

Coating ECUs, lighting modules, and power control boards to ensure long-term reliability under heat and vibration.
